Job Position: Marine Assurance Supervisor

Location: Lagos
Employment Type: Contract

Job Description

  1. Provide Marine assurance support to SCiN Marine activities. Provide input for marine support with other Business Partners at the planning/implementation phase, ensuring HAZID recommendations are met.
  2. Coordinating and monitoring vessel assurance activities and personnel (contractors and staff)
  3. Maintain and update relevant systems (GMAS, SharePoint) and documents
  4. Maintain Marine Assurance Trackers for vessels, vessel operators, jetties, terminals and supply bases
  5. Ensure Marine Assurance approvals are in place before vessel usage
  6. Conduct marine vessel MFE engagements with vessels and combine with ride-on vessel attendances with overnight stays onboard.
  7. Inspection of all Mobile Offshore Drilling Units, including Jack-up Barges and Project Barges
  8. Anchor patterns and mooring procedures review, and vessel stability analysis
  9. Dynamically Positioned (DP) station keeping onboard review and trials
  10. Desktop review of DP vessels,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(FMEA), Annual DP trial and FMEA proving trial reports
  11. Desktop review of nominated vessels’ documentation before onboard attendance
  12. Periodic in-service assurance on contracted vessels
  13. Support with Vessel Operator HSE Capability Assessment reviews
  14. Support the Marine Assurance Team in liaising with the Project in guiding vessel assurance requirements.
  15. Closeout verification onboard support vessels following initial inspection or post-breakdown repairs
  16. Support the Marine Assurance team with incident investigation
  17. Form part of the Marine Duty Supervisor call-out rota for out-of-hours support
  18. Support Marine Assurance Contractor call-offs for inspections and other assurance activities

Additional Requirements
1 No Marine Assurance Supervisor, office-based in Lagos:

  1. A minimum of Master Class 1 or Chief Engineer Class 1 Foreign Going Certificate of Competency.
  2. At least 15 years’ experience in Marine Transport Logistics Business of which 10 years must be sea-going experience with at least 5 years at a management level.
  3. Candidates with a Class 2 Deck or Engineer Certificate of competency (Unlimited) with more than 5 years sea-going experience at a management level will also be considered
